A Graduate Certificate in Strategic Partnerships in Fashion Logistics equips professionals with the advanced skills needed to navigate the complexities of the global fashion supply chain. This program focuses on building and managing strategic alliances, optimizing logistics operations, and leveraging technology for enhanced efficiency and sustainability.
Learning outcomes include a deep understanding of international trade regulations, supply chain risk management, and the development of collaborative strategies for sourcing, production, and distribution. Graduates will be proficient in negotiating contracts, managing supplier relationships, and implementing sustainable practices throughout the fashion logistics process. They will also gain expertise in using data analytics for improved decision-making in the context of global fashion retail.
The program's duration is typically designed to be completed within one academic year, although specific timelines may vary depending on the institution. This intensive, focused curriculum ensures that participants gain the practical skills and theoretical knowledge quickly, allowing for immediate application in their professional roles. The program often features flexible learning options, such as online or blended learning models, accommodating working professionals' schedules.
